Position Summary
The Lab Assistant will assist the QC department with routine tasks, with particular emphasis on the stability program and sample submission to third-party labs. The Lab Assistant will be trained on day-to-day operations in the Quality Control lab. Part of the purpose of this position is to educate the employee and introduce them to quality principles and analytical chemistry in a regulated manufacturing environment.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
• Submit samples to third-party laboratories for testing
• Assist with the management of the stability program: Initiate stability studies, pull samples, submit samples to the required lab for testing, enter results into applicable reports and trackers, and write stability reports
• Assist with day-to-day operations in the QC lab: Preparing solutions (standards, mobile phases, diluents), hazardous waste management, cleaning the lab, and performing the daily checklist
• After mastering the above duties, the Lab Assistant will be trained to perform tests in the lab. This involves sample preparation, analysis (typically with HPLC or GC-MS), data work-up, and data review
• Assist the QA team with managing retains and data management
